黑狐家游戏

业务架构和应用架构的区别和联系是什么,业务架构和应用架构的区别和联系

欧气 3 0

标题:《深度剖析:业务架构与应用架构的区别与联系》

在当今数字化时代,企业的信息化建设日益复杂,业务架构和应用架构作为其中的关键组成部分,对于企业的成功至关重要,很多人对于业务架构和应用架构的区别和联系并不十分清楚,导致在实际工作中出现混淆和误解,本文将深入探讨业务架构和应用架构的区别和联系,帮助读者更好地理解这两个重要的概念。

一、业务架构和应用架构的定义

业务架构是对企业业务的全面描述,包括业务流程、业务功能、业务组织、业务数据等方面,它旨在明确企业的业务目标、业务策略和业务模式,为企业的战略规划和业务发展提供指导,业务架构的主要目的是确保企业的业务能够高效、灵活地运行,满足客户的需求,并实现企业的战略目标。

应用架构是对企业应用系统的总体设计,包括应用系统的功能、架构、接口、数据等方面,它旨在构建一个高效、可靠、可扩展的应用系统架构,为企业的业务运营提供支持,应用架构的主要目的是确保应用系统能够满足业务需求,并且能够与其他应用系统进行有效的集成和交互。

二、业务架构和应用架构的区别

1、关注的重点不同

业务架构关注的重点是企业的业务,包括业务流程、业务功能、业务组织、业务数据等方面,它旨在明确企业的业务目标、业务策略和业务模式,为企业的战略规划和业务发展提供指导,应用架构关注的重点是企业的应用系统,包括应用系统的功能、架构、接口、数据等方面,它旨在构建一个高效、可靠、可扩展的应用系统架构,为企业的业务运营提供支持。

2、设计的层次不同

业务架构是企业架构的一个层次,它位于企业战略和业务流程之间,业务架构的设计旨在将企业战略转化为业务流程和业务功能,为企业的业务运营提供指导,应用架构是企业架构的另一个层次,它位于业务架构和技术架构之间,应用架构的设计旨在将业务流程和业务功能转化为应用系统的功能、架构、接口、数据等方面,为企业的应用系统开发提供指导。

3、设计的方法不同

业务架构的设计通常采用业务建模的方法,通过建立业务模型来描述企业的业务流程、业务功能、业务组织、业务数据等方面,业务建模的方法通常包括业务流程建模、业务功能建模、业务组织建模、业务数据建模等方面,应用架构的设计通常采用系统建模的方法,通过建立系统模型来描述应用系统的功能、架构、接口、数据等方面,系统建模的方法通常包括用例建模、类建模、组件建模、部署建模等方面。

4、设计的目的不同

业务架构的设计目的是为了明确企业的业务目标、业务策略和业务模式,为企业的战略规划和业务发展提供指导,应用架构的设计目的是为了构建一个高效、可靠、可扩展的应用系统架构,为企业的业务运营提供支持。

三、业务架构和应用架构的联系

1、业务架构是应用架构的基础

业务架构是企业架构的一个层次,它位于企业战略和业务流程之间,业务架构的设计旨在将企业战略转化为业务流程和业务功能,为企业的业务运营提供指导,应用架构是企业架构的另一个层次,它位于业务架构和技术架构之间,应用架构的设计旨在将业务流程和业务功能转化为应用系统的功能、架构、接口、数据等方面,为企业的应用系统开发提供指导,业务架构是应用架构的基础,没有明确的业务架构,应用架构的设计就会缺乏方向和目标。

2、应用架构是业务架构的实现

应用架构是对企业应用系统的总体设计,它旨在构建一个高效、可靠、可扩展的应用系统架构,为企业的业务运营提供支持,业务架构是对企业业务的全面描述,它旨在明确企业的业务目标、业务策略和业务模式,为企业的战略规划和业务发展提供指导,应用架构是业务架构的实现,它将业务架构中的业务流程、业务功能、业务组织、业务数据等方面转化为应用系统的功能、架构、接口、数据等方面,为企业的业务运营提供支持。

3、业务架构和应用架构相互影响

业务架构和应用架构是相互影响的,它们之间存在着密切的关系,业务架构的设计会影响应用架构的设计,业务架构中的业务流程、业务功能、业务组织、业务数据等方面的变化会导致应用架构中的应用系统的功能、架构、接口、数据等方面的变化,应用架构的设计也会影响业务架构的设计,应用架构中的应用系统的功能、架构、接口、数据等方面的变化会导致业务架构中的业务流程、业务功能、业务组织、业务数据等方面的变化。

四、如何进行业务架构和应用架构的设计

1、明确业务目标和业务策略

在进行业务架构和应用架构的设计之前,首先需要明确企业的业务目标和业务策略,业务目标是企业希望通过业务运营实现的目标,业务策略是企业为了实现业务目标而采取的策略和措施,只有明确了企业的业务目标和业务策略,才能为业务架构和应用架构的设计提供指导。

2、进行业务流程建模

业务流程建模是业务架构设计的重要环节,它通过建立业务流程模型来描述企业的业务流程,业务流程建模的方法通常包括业务流程建模、业务功能建模、业务组织建模、业务数据建模等方面,通过业务流程建模,可以清晰地了解企业的业务流程,发现业务流程中的问题和不足,为业务流程的优化和改进提供依据。

3、进行应用架构设计

应用架构设计是应用架构设计的重要环节,它通过建立应用系统模型来描述应用系统的功能、架构、接口、数据等方面,应用架构设计的方法通常包括用例建模、类建模、组件建模、部署建模等方面,通过应用架构设计,可以清晰地了解应用系统的功能和架构,为应用系统的开发和实施提供指导。

4、进行业务架构和应用架构的集成

业务架构和应用架构是相互关联的,它们之间需要进行有效的集成,在进行业务架构和应用架构的集成时,需要考虑业务流程、业务功能、业务组织、业务数据等方面的一致性和协调性,通过业务架构和应用架构的集成,可以确保业务架构和应用架构的一致性和协调性,提高企业的信息化水平和竞争力。

五、结论

业务架构和应用架构是企业信息化建设中不可或缺的两个重要组成部分,它们之间存在着密切的关系,业务架构是应用架构的基础,应用架构是业务架构的实现,它们相互影响、相互促进,在进行企业信息化建设时,需要充分认识到业务架构和应用架构的区别和联系,合理地进行业务架构和应用架构的设计和实施,以提高企业的信息化水平和竞争力。

标签: #业务架构 #应用架构 #区别 #联系

黑狐家游戏
  • 评论列表

留言评论